Mesothelioma Attorney

A mesothelioma attorney can assist the victims and their families in filing a claim for financial compensation. There are different types of mesothelioma claims, including personal injury and wrongful death.

Mesothelioma attorneys must have expertise in asbestos litigation and be aware of the laws from multiple states. National firms are able to submit your case in the state or state that is most beneficial for your case.

Experience

A professional mesothelioma lawyer who is reputable will be well-versed in asbestos litigation and have a vast background in handling these kinds of claims. They should have a demonstrated track record, with notable settlements and jury verdicts. They should be able explain the various options for pursuing compensation such as filing a lawsuit or obtaining an award of settlement.

Mesothelioma is a rare form of cancer that affects the tissues that are found in the lungs, stomach and the heart. Individuals who have been exposed to asbestos can suffer from a variety of symptoms, including respiratory issues, persistent sneezing, difficulty swallowing, and discomfort in the chest, abdomen and arms.

Compensation for mesothelioma-related cancers can help patients recover their medical costs funeral expenses, lost income and other losses. A skilled lawyer can accurately determine the extent of the damage suffered by an individual victim and secure the maximum amount of compensation for his family.

It can be overwhelming to discover that you have mesothelioma or another asbestos-related disease. A mesothelioma lawyer can ease the burden of the family by handling all aspects of the case. This includes gathering evidence, taking depositions and arguing on behalf of their client in court.

A good mesothelioma lawyer will provide their clients with free case evaluation. National firms such as Weitz & Luxenberg, Cooney & Conway and others offer the evaluations both in New York City as well as across the nation. They will also visit victims, and often have more availability for scheduling than local lawyers. They also operate on a contingent fee basis which means that their clients don't have to pay upfront legal fees. Asbestos lawyers only receive compensation when they receive compensation for their clients.

Knowledge of the Law

The lawyers you choose to work with should have a deep knowledge of asbestos laws and how they relate to your case. They must also be able of explaining complicated legal concepts in easy to understand terms.

Top mesothelioma lawyers have a track record of successfully getting compensation for their clients. The compensation is intended to help victims and their loved ones pay for medical expenses as well as manage the loss of wages and cover the costs of in-home nursing care.

Asbestos lawsuits can be complicated and can involve multiple parties. A reputable mesothelioma lawyer should be able to work with medical experts as well as insurance companies and financial institutions to obtain the best possible outcome for their client.

Some cases are settled outside of court while others are argued. The best lawyers are familiar with both types of trials. They will also develop a plan for how to structure your claim with the help of evidence available.

Top mesothelioma lawyers have an track record of winning large settlements and verdicts. They have the expertise and the ability to take on large corporations that exposed people to asbestos. Attorneys at the national firm Weitz & Luxenberg, for instance, have secured multimillion dollar settlements for their clients. They recently secured $13 million in damages against Colgate-Palmolive on behalf of a woman who developed mesothelioma after using the popular Cashmere Bouquet Talcum Powder.

A mesothelioma lawyer's job is to assist a client to file a claim for legal aid and fight for the most possible compensation. They can assist with the preparation of medical records and working with insurance companies. A knowledgeable mesothelioma lawyer will also ensure that the victim's rights are protected throughout the process. Many lawyers offer no-obligation, free consultations on mesothelioma.

Settlements

Mesothelioma compensation could help a family pay for medical treatment and other expenses. A successful claim can also be used to pay for funeral expenses, lost wages, future loss of income, legal fees, and suffering and pain. Mesothelioma attorneys are experienced in asbestos litigation and can help with filing claims.

Lawyers who have experience in mesothelioma could be able to determine possible sources of exposure quickly. This information can then be used to build mesothelioma claims against asbestos companies and manufacturers accountable for the exposure. Lawyers at law firms that specialize in asbestos litigation are experts in the best strategies to collect compensation from the defendants.

A successful mesothelioma lawsuit typically results in a settlement. However, in certain cases a trial is necessary to ensure the victim receives a fair amount of compensation. Mesothelioma patients and their families must be able to access a lawyer who has experience in trial preparation and has been successful in obtaining compensation for his clients.

A mesothelioma lawyer firm in the United States can assist asbestos patients and their families learn about their rights and file a mesothelioma claim. They have worked with local courts and can decide where lawsuits can be filed based on laws and statutes in every state. They can hire experts such as industrial hygienists or physicians to handle the case on behalf of their clients. They can help with benefits from trust funds as well as other sources of compensation. They can also assist with appeals in case a settlement cannot be reached. This allows their clients to focus on treatment and their loved ones. They can also assist them claim workers compensation if they meet the requirements.
